This dataset provides Census 2021 estimates that classify households in England and Wales by multi religion households. The estimates are as at Census Day, 21 March 2021.

Summary

Classifies households by whether members identify with the same religion, no religion, did not answer the question, or a combination of these options.

This question was voluntary and the variable includes those who answered the question alongside those who chose not to.

Multi religion household: Total 167
One-person household 72
Multi-person household: No people stated their religion 5
Multi-person household: Same religion (at least one person has stated a religion but the household may include people who di 60
Multi-person household: No religion (household may include people who did not state their religion) 15
Multi-person household: Same religion and no religion (household may include people who did not state their religion) 14
Multi-person household: At least two different religions stated (household may include people with no religion and who did n 1
